The Detective Branch (DB) of Dhaka Metropolitan Police (DMP) has seized a huge number of arms, including pistols and magazines, from a house in the capital’s Vatara area.
Police also arrested seven people in this connection on Saturday. The arrestees were identified as Rasheduzzaman Khan Raju, 35, son of Aman Khan, Rakib Hossain Munna, 32, son of Shamim Hossain,  Sharikul Islam Khan, 45, of Shariat Khan, Md Azim Patwari, 34, son of  Badiuzzaman Patwari,  Md Mahbub Khan, 35, son of  Shukur Mahmud, Sharif Khan, 33, son of Akkas Khan,  and  Md Sohrab Khan,33, son of Azizul Islam. All of them possessed the arms.
The law enforcers claimed that they recovered   two foreign pistols, a foreign made revolver, a foreign made short gun, an  old revolver with parts from a bathroom near the family graveyard of Khapara Raju.
They also recovered two rounds of cartridges of shotgun, 210 rounds of shell casings, five old magazines, 40 grammes of gunpowder-like substance, 60 pieces of small parts of various weapons from the spot.
 The Chief of DB police, Hurun-or–Rashid, came up with the statement while addressing a press conference at DMP Media Centre in the capital.
On 18 March, police arrested Rasheduzzaman Khan Raju and Rakib Hossain Munna for firing Md Rubel Hossain with a pistol following a quarrel over number plates of rickshaw at Jomoj Road in Joarsahara.  
  DMP said that  in order to arrest the accused involved in the crime and recover the firearms, the aforementioned accused were arrested by conducting raids in different places of Gazipur, Madaripur and Dinajpur districts with the help of Intelligence sources.
